

Honeymooning couple Monica and Mike check into a motel in New Mexico. All seems normal until an ambulance pulls up and abducts Mike. Monica narrowly escapes and, with the help of truck driver Bill, discovers the awful secret of the motel and the ambulance service.

Trivia, insights & behind the scenes
Made for German TV but shot in New Mexico with an international cast—pure 1970s Euro co-production chaos that accidentally captures American anxieties about healthcare.
Director Rainer Erler was primarily a documentary filmmaker; this was his rare fiction outing, which explains the almost news-footage detachment during the horror sequences.
